Performanz-Workshop bei WGV-Versicherungen in Stuttgart

Am 27.02.2015 fand bei der WGV-Versicherung in Stuttgart der Performanz Workshop statt. Uwe Simon von T-Systems hat sich dazu eine umfassende Agenda überlegt und durch den Workshop geführt. Er hat sich bereit erklärt, sein umfassendes Wissen und seine Erfahrung mit Oracle-Datenbanken aus über 20 Jahren zu präsentieren und mit den Teilnehmern über generelle und aber auch spezifische Probleme aus dem Alltag zu diskutieren. Die Diskussion kam auch schnell in Gang und es wurde gestaunt und fachgesimpelt. Ein erstes Feedback der Teilnehmer zeigte, dass für jeden etwas dabei war.

Vielen Dank an Uwe Simon von T-Systems und an die WGV-Versicherungen. Die WGV hat für den Workshop den Besprechungsraum gestellt und für die Verpflegung gesorgt.

Der Vorstand der IUG

Impressionen der Veranstaltung komprimiert zusammengefasst:

 

Die von Uwe Simon präsentierten Folien stehen zum Download bereit. Allerdings müssen Sie registrierter User
der ICIS-User-Group.de sein.

 

Agenda vom 27.02.2015

  • Allgemeines (Von der Query zum Ausführungsplan)
  • Optimizerstrategien (Nested-Loop, Hash-Join, wann ist welche sinnvoll, …)
  • Indexe
  • Zugriffsstrategien (Full-Scan, Range-Scan, Skip-Scan, …)
  • Optimizer (Modes, Optimizer-Statistiken, Dynamic-Sampling, …)
  • Buffercache
  • Einflüssen auf Sortierungen (SORT_AREA_SIZE, …)
  • Lokalisieren von Performanzproblemen (IO-Waittimes, Buffergets, CPU-time, …)
  • IO-Waits, Lockwaits, Latch-Waits, …
  • Indexe (wann, welche, wie nutzen, …)
  • Meine Query ist mittags immer langsamer als morgens (warum, was dagegen machen)
  • Ausführungsplan sieht OK aus, ist aber trotzdem zu langsam (was tun, …)
  • Einflüsse der Datenverteilung auf Laufzeiten
  • Temporäre Tabellen
  • Wann geht es nicht mehr schneller (IO-Wartezeiten, Menge der IOs, CPU-Zeiten, …)
  • Parallel-Query (wann, wie, …)
  • Materialized Views, Query-Rewrite, Result-Cache (wann, wie,…)
  • Wechselnde Ausführungspläne (wann, wieso, …)
  • Fixieren von Ausführungs-Plänen (Statistiken fixieren, Optimizer-Hints, Stored-Outlines, SQL-Profiles, …)
  • Ausblick 12c

 

 

  

Wir nutzen Cookies auf unserer Website. Einige von ihnen sind essenziell für den Betrieb der Seite, während andere uns helfen, diese Website und die Nutzererfahrung zu verbessern (Tracking Cookies). Sie können selbst entscheiden, ob Sie die Cookies zulassen möchten. Bitte beachten Sie, dass bei einer Ablehnung womöglich nicht mehr alle Funktionalitäten der Seite zur Verfügung stehen.